Senior Software Engineer - Backend (Python, Go, C++)
Ambient.aiJob Overview
Ambient.ai is seeking a Senior Software Engineer - Backend to join our dynamic engineering team in San Francisco, California. As a Senior Software Engineer, you will be instrumental in designing, building, scaling, and operating large-scale distributed systems. Your role will involve leveraging your strong analytical and debugging skills to ensure the robustness and reliability of our systems. You will thrive in a fast-paced, rapidly changing environment and will possess a strong bias towards action and delivering results, all while maintaining a keen eye for high-quality work.
Key Responsibilities
- Design and Build: Develop and maintain large-scale distributed systems, ensuring their performance, reliability, and scalability.
- Troubleshooting: Utilize strong analytical and debugging skills to troubleshoot and resolve complex system issues.
- Collaboration: Work with cross-functional teams to define, design, and deliver new features and enhancements.
- Mentorship: Mentor and guide junior engineers, fostering a culture of continuous learning and improvement.
- Adaptability: Quickly adapt to changing environments and new technologies.
- Programming: Leverage expertise in one or more programming languages, such as Python, Go, or C++.
Required Skills and Experience
- Proven experience in designing, building, scaling, and operating large-scale distributed systems.
- Strong analytical and debugging skills, with a demonstrated ability to troubleshoot complex issues.
- Proficiency in working with Unix-based systems.
- Expertise in one or more programming languages such as Python, Go, or C++.
- Excellent problem-solving skills and a strong attention to detail.
- Strong communication skills, with the ability to work effectively in a team environment.
- A passion for continuous learning and staying up-to-date with the latest industry trends and technologies.
Why Join Us
- Innovative Work: Be part of a team creating an entirely new category within a 180+ billion-dollar physical security industry.
- Impressive Clientele: Work with Fortune 500 companies including Adobe, VMware, and LinkedIn.
- Ownership: Regular full-time employees receive stock options for the opportunity to share ownership in the success of our company.
- Work-Life Balance: Enjoy generous time off to rest and recharge, including Winter Break.
- Community: Connect with your awesome co-workers through various opportunities.
Compensation
We take a market-based approach to pay here at Ambient.ai, and pay may vary depending on multiple factors. The successful candidate’s starting pay will be determined based on job-related skills, experience, qualifications, work location, level, market conditions, and internal parity. The pay scale below represents the starting base salary range we expect to pay for this position, and is subject to change:
- SF Bay Area: €168,000 - €200,000
Ambient.ai is proud to be an Equal Opportunity Employer. We do not unlawfully discriminate on the basis of race, color, religion, sex, gender identity, national origin, age, disability, or any other basis protected by local, state, or federal laws.
Benefits Extracted with AI
- Stock options
- Generous time off including Winter Break
- Latest tech and swag
- Opportunities to connect with co-workers
Similar jobs
Last update: 23 minutes ago
Senior Software Engineer (Backend) - TypeScript & Go
Join Scout AI as a Senior Backend Engineer to build scalable blockchain systems using TypeScript and Go.
Senior Backend Engineer (AI)
Join Stability AI as a Senior Backend Engineer to develop REST APIs and AI/ML services for Generative AI models.
Senior Software Engineer, Platform
Join Augment AI as a Senior Software Engineer to build AI-driven platforms using AWS, Ruby, and Python. Enjoy great benefits and stock options.
Senior Backend Engineer (Golang)
Join SumUp as a Senior Backend Engineer (Golang) in Sofia to build resilient systems and APIs, ensuring high availability and observability.
Backend Software Engineer
Join OpenAI as a Backend Software Engineer to develop platform capabilities and integrate systems using AI.
Senior Software Engineer (Full-Stack)
Join Parrot as a Senior Software Engineer (Full-Stack) to build AI-driven web applications and backend services.
Senior Backend Engineer
Join Somewear Labs as a Senior Backend Engineer to develop life-saving communication platforms using Spring, Redis, and AWS.
Senior Backend Engineer (Node.js, Go)
Join Sprig as a Senior Backend Engineer to design and maintain scalable backend systems using Node.js and Go.
Software Engineer - Application Platform
Join Abnormal Security as a Software Engineer to build scalable platforms using Python, Go, and more. Remote role.
Senior Backend Engineer - Temporal
Join Abridge as a Senior Backend Engineer to build cloud-native applications using Temporal and Node.js.
Senior/Staff Software Engineer - Backend/Python
Join Close as a Senior/Staff Software Engineer to design and scale backend systems using Python and AWS. 100% remote, USA-based.
Backend Software Engineer (Python, Cloud, Kubernetes)
Join Aignostics as a Backend Software Engineer to develop infrastructure for AI-powered diagnostics.
Software Engineer II, Backend - Cloud & Platform Team
Join Uber's Cloud & Platform team as a Backend Software Engineer to build tools for cloud resource management.
Software Engineer - Full Stack
Join Uplimit as a Full Stack Software Engineer to build AI-powered learning platforms. Work on cutting-edge AI projects in a hybrid environment.
Senior Backend Software Engineer - API
Join Perplexity as a Senior Backend Software Engineer to design and scale API systems using Python, PostgreSQL, and Kubernetes.
Senior Backend Engineer
Join onX as a Senior Backend Engineer to develop scalable services for our Backcountry app. Remote role with competitive salary and benefits.
Remote Senior Software Engineer (Python)
Remote Senior Software Engineer role at Pelago, focusing on Python, AWS, and cloud-native architectures.
Senior Backend Engineer - Growth Team
Join Fireflies.ai as a Senior Backend Engineer to drive growth through innovative backend solutions. Remote position.
Senior Software Engineer, Platform
Join Augment AI as a Senior Software Engineer to build AI-driven platforms. Work with AWS, Ruby, Python, and more. Remote or hybrid options available.
Backend Engineer, Platform
Join Labelbox as a Backend Engineer to develop secure IAM services for AI platforms. Work with TypeScript, JavaScript, and cloud technologies.
Senior Software Engineer - Python
Join Gorgias as a Senior Software Engineer specializing in Python, Node.js, and REST APIs. Hybrid role in New York with excellent benefits.
Senior Back End Developer (Golang)
Join instacar as a Senior Back End Developer specializing in Golang. Work on large-scale applications in a dynamic, innovative environment.
Senior Backend Software Engineer - Earnings Experience
Join Uber as a Senior Backend Software Engineer to build scalable systems for earnings experience.
Senior Software Engineer - Python
Join Gorgias as a Senior Software Engineer in Python, working on API development and app integrations in a hybrid role in New York.